Is It Worth Paying for Acting Classes?

    Aspiring actors often face the dilemma of whether to invest in acting classes. Acting, like any skill, requires practice, guidance, and refinement, and for many, classes can offer a valuable foundation. But the question remains: is it worth paying for acting classes? In this article, we’ll examine the benefits and drawbacks of taking acting classes and help you decide whether they’re a worthwhile investment for your acting career.

    The Benefits of Paying for Acting Classes

    1. Professional Guidance and Feedback One of the most significant advantages of paying for acting classes is the opportunity to learn from experienced professionals. Acting coaches and instructors bring years of experience, industry knowledge, and a deep understanding of the craft. They provide constructive feedback, helping students refine their technique, work on their weaknesses, and improve their performance skills. This expert guidance is invaluable, particularly for beginners who need direction.

    2. Structured Learning Environment Acting classes provide a structured environment where you can focus on honing your craft. Classes often follow a curriculum designed to build your skills gradually, ensuring that you master the basics before moving on to more advanced techniques. This structured approach helps you develop a solid foundation, which can be difficult to achieve on your own without a clear roadmap. Structured learning ensures you’re not just practicing acting but practicing it in the right way.

    3. Hands-On Experience and Practice Acting is a practical skill that improves with consistent practice. Paying for acting classes gives you the opportunity to perform regularly, whether in front of classmates, during scene work, or in class productions. This hands-on experience is crucial for growth as an actor. The more you perform and get out of your comfort zone, the better you’ll become. Acting classes also provide a safe space for experimentation, where you can explore different types of roles and emotions without the pressure of a professional production.

    4. Networking and Industry Connections Acting classes are also a great place to network. Whether it’s with other aspiring actors, directors, casting agents, or industry professionals who sometimes guest lecture or participate in classes, acting classes can open doors for future opportunities. Building relationships with others in the industry is vital, as many acting gigs come through personal connections. Additionally, instructors often have their own networks and may be able to recommend you for auditions or refer you to reputable talent agencies.

    5. Confidence Building Acting classes can significantly improve your self-confidence. By participating in exercises, performing in front of others, and receiving positive feedback, you gain confidence in your ability to act. This newfound self-assurance will not only help you perform better in class but also in auditions and actual roles. Confidence is key to standing out in a competitive industry like acting, and regular practice in a supportive environment will make you more comfortable with your skills.

    6. Learning Industry-Specific Skills Acting classes can teach you more than just how to act—they also provide you with skills specific to the acting industry. This includes learning how to prepare for auditions, understanding casting calls, breaking down a script, working with directors, and handling the business side of the industry (such as headshots, resumes, and agents). These are important lessons that will make you more professional and prepared as you enter the field.

    Drawbacks of Paying for Acting Classes

    1. Cost of Classes One of the main concerns for many aspiring actors is the cost. Acting classes can be expensive, and the price may vary depending on the level of the class, the instructor’s reputation, and the location. Some classes can cost hundreds or even thousands of dollars, especially in major cities like Los Angeles or New York. If you’re just starting out and unsure whether acting is the right path for you, this investment may feel like a financial risk. While many classes offer great value, you should carefully evaluate whether the cost fits within your budget.

    2. Inconsistent Quality Not all acting classes are created equal, and not every instructor may be the right fit for you. While some acting coaches have years of industry experience and can offer invaluable lessons, others may be less experienced or not as skilled in teaching. It’s important to do your research and read reviews before committing to any class. A bad experience in a poorly structured or ineffective class could hinder your progress and waste your time and money.

    3. Limited Real-World Experience While acting classes offer a safe space for practice, they can’t fully replicate the real-world experience of working on a professional production. While you’ll learn the basics and get a good feel for the craft, there’s no substitute for actual acting experience in front of cameras or a live audience. Some critics argue that acting classes can be overly theoretical or structured, and don’t provide enough opportunities to gain industry experience, which is vital for building a successful acting career.

    4. The Pressure to “Find the Right Class” For new actors, finding the right class can be a daunting task. Some classes may focus on specific techniques or styles (such as Meisner, Stanislavski, or improv), and finding one that aligns with your learning style can take time. You may end up wasting money on classes that don’t meet your needs, leading to frustration and a feeling of being overwhelmed. The process of figuring out where to start can be just as challenging as the classes themselves.

    5. No Guarantees While acting classes can teach you important skills, there are no guarantees that taking a class will directly lead to acting opportunities or success. The acting industry is highly competitive, and landing roles depends on a variety of factors such as talent, timing, networking, and luck. Even after completing classes, it’s possible that you may not immediately see the results you’re hoping for. Success in acting often takes years of persistence and resilience.

    Conclusion: Is It Worth Paying for Acting Classes?

    Ultimately, the decision to pay for acting classes depends on your goals, budget, and commitment to pursuing acting as a career. If you’re serious about developing your craft, gaining industry-specific knowledge, and building your confidence, paying for acting classes can be an excellent investment. The guidance, structure, and hands-on experience provided in professional classes can set you up for long-term success in the industry.

    However, if you’re unsure whether acting is the right path for you, or if you’re unable to afford the high cost of classes, there are alternative options available. You can seek free or low-cost workshops, watch online tutorials, or practice on your own before committing to paid classes.
    In the end, acting classes are an important part of an actor’s growth, but they are just one piece of the puzzle. Passion, persistence, and real-world experience are equally crucial for anyone hoping to make it in the competitive world of acting. If you’re dedicated and ready to invest in your future, acting classes can be a valuable resource for getting you closer to your goals.
